Job Duties:

A part-time LTE position is currently available in University Police. The working title for this assignment is Police Officer with an official title of Police Officer I. Work is performed under supervision of the Chief of University Police. Responsibilities include but are not limited to: Enforcing laws investigates complaints and incidents maintains order identifies criminal activity and apprehends and arrest offenders to ensure the safety and security of all institutional properties. This is a sworn law enforcement position under the general direction of a supervisor.

Key Job Responsibilities:

  • Provides personal safety and crime prevention education to institutional community
  • Provides protection of life property and the preservation of peace and good order and provides emergency aid to the institutional community
  • Engages in problem solving threat mitigation and conflict resolution for a wide range of issues and incidents involving citizens groups campus entities government agencies businesses leaders and others
  • Performs preliminary and follow-up investigations to solve crimes identify suspects and victims apprehend criminals and document case information
  • Ensures the safe and orderly flow of traffic on institutional roadways and enforces traffic laws

Department:

The unit of University Police is committed to providing quality law enforcement and public safety services to students faculty staff and visitors.The unit consists of a chief of police two sergeants six full-time officers a police services associate and varying part-time officers. expected hourly hiring salary will be based on qualifications and experience.

Required Qualifications:

  • Associate degree from a regionally accredited institution.
  • Certification or ability to be certified by Wisconsin Department of Justice Training and Standards Bureau as a Police Officer in the State of Wisconsin.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Bachelors degree from a regionally accredited institution.
  • Evidence of working collaboratively in a college or university setting.
  • Demonstrated ability to work collaboratively with local and regional policing agencies.
  • Demonstrated commitment to equity diversity and inclusiveness.

INSTITUTIONAL OVERVIEW

UW-Eau Claire an institution of approximately 9000 students and 1200 faculty and staff is consistently recognized as a top comprehensive university in the Midwest and is widely known as a leader in faculty-undergraduate research and study abroad. We strive for excellence in liberal education and select graduate and professional programs through commitment to teaching and learning and dedication to our core values of diversity sustainability leadership and innovation. To learn more about UWEC visit .

The City of Eau Claire situated at the confluence of the Chippewa and Eau Claire rivers is at the center of a metropolitan area of approximately 100000 people located 90 miles east of Minneapolis/St. Paul. The area features beautiful parks and trails strong public schools a vibrant arts scene and local food culture and abundant recreational opportunities.
